Output 06c90343696f1d65e1d316deccba52f02cc55b577b2fb5e62c0833b564cd20b8:45

value
24509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08570d070a017c5f6bb58db82530af857cc41078 OP_EQUAL
address
32T7cUoZu5MD2Z7oyaSaQi7Ek7QLe1Z4tv
transaction
06c90343696f1d65e1d316deccba52f02cc55b577b2fb5e62c0833b564cd20b8
confirmations
90411
spent
true